SchemaRegistry interface
Интерфейс, представляющий SchemaRegistry.
Методы
| create |
Создает или обновляет группу схем EventHub. |
| delete(string, string, string, Schema |
Удаляет группу схем EventHub. |
| get(string, string, string, Schema |
Возвращает сведения о группе схем EventHub. |
| list |
Возвращает все группы схем в пространстве имен. |
Сведения о методе
createOrUpdate(string, string, string, SchemaGroup, SchemaRegistryCreateOrUpdateOptionalParams)
Создает или обновляет группу схем EventHub.
function createOrUpdate(resourceGroupName: string, namespaceName: string, schemaGroupName: string, parameters: SchemaGroup, options?: SchemaRegistryCreateOrUpdateOptionalParams): Promise<SchemaGroup>
Параметры
- resourceGroupName
-
string
Имя группы ресурсов в подписке Azure.
- namespaceName
-
string
Имя пространства имен
- schemaGroupName
-
string
Имя группы схем
- parameters
- SchemaGroup
Параметры, предоставленные для создания ресурса Концентратора событий.
Параметры параметров.
Возвращаемое значение
Promise<SchemaGroup>
delete(string, string, string, SchemaRegistryDeleteOptionalParams)
Удаляет группу схем EventHub.
function delete(resourceGroupName: string, namespaceName: string, schemaGroupName: string, options?: SchemaRegistryDeleteOptionalParams): Promise<void>
Параметры
- resourceGroupName
-
string
Имя группы ресурсов в подписке Azure.
- namespaceName
-
string
Имя пространства имен
- schemaGroupName
-
string
Имя группы схем
Параметры параметров.
Возвращаемое значение
Promise<void>
get(string, string, string, SchemaRegistryGetOptionalParams)
Возвращает сведения о группе схем EventHub.
function get(resourceGroupName: string, namespaceName: string, schemaGroupName: string, options?: SchemaRegistryGetOptionalParams): Promise<SchemaGroup>
Параметры
- resourceGroupName
-
string
Имя группы ресурсов в подписке Azure.
- namespaceName
-
string
Имя пространства имен
- schemaGroupName
-
string
Имя группы схем
- options
- SchemaRegistryGetOptionalParams
Параметры параметров.
Возвращаемое значение
Promise<SchemaGroup>
listByNamespace(string, string, SchemaRegistryListByNamespaceOptionalParams)
Возвращает все группы схем в пространстве имен.
function listByNamespace(resourceGroupName: string, namespaceName: string, options?: SchemaRegistryListByNamespaceOptionalParams): PagedAsyncIterableIterator<SchemaGroup, SchemaGroup[], PageSettings>
Параметры
- resourceGroupName
-
string
Имя группы ресурсов в подписке Azure.
- namespaceName
-
string
Имя пространства имен
Параметры параметров.